From aee46bfc3cba9ec3ea0920e686b60acf157bfe89 Mon Sep 17 00:00:00 2001 From: Marisa Kirisame Date: Mon, 14 Feb 2022 01:14:50 +0100 Subject: [PATCH] Fix some badly written code. --- language.version | 4 ++-- zscript/utility/swwm_utility.zsc | 6 +++---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/language.version b/language.version index c89143213..fa023b19f 100644 --- a/language.version +++ b/language.version @@ -1,3 +1,3 @@ [default] -SWWM_MODVER="\cyDEMOLITIONIST \cw1.2pre r157 \cu(Sun 13 Feb 23:13:14 CET 2022)\c-"; -SWWM_SHORTVER="\cw1.2pre r157 \cu(2022-02-13 23:13:14)\c-"; +SWWM_MODVER="\cyDEMOLITIONIST \cw1.2pre r158 \cu(Mon 14 Feb 01:14:50 CET 2022)\c-"; +SWWM_SHORTVER="\cw1.2pre r158 \cu(2022-02-14 01:14:50)\c-"; diff --git a/zscript/utility/swwm_utility.zsc b/zscript/utility/swwm_utility.zsc index 0843258b4..d86db34a9 100644 --- a/zscript/utility/swwm_utility.zsc +++ b/zscript/utility/swwm_utility.zsc @@ -608,17 +608,17 @@ Class SWWMUtility q = (maxclip.y-v0.y); break; } - if ( (p == 0.) && (q<0.) ) return false; + if ( (p == 0.) && (q<0.) ) return false, (0,0), (0,0); if ( p < 0 ) { r = q/p; - if ( r > t1 ) return false; + if ( r > t1 ) return false, (0,0), (0,0); else if ( r > t0 ) t0 = r; } else if ( p > 0 ) { r = q/p; - if ( r < t0 ) return false; + if ( r < t0 ) return false, (0,0), (0,0); else if ( r < t1 ) t1 = r; } }